Allign offline repos for q3

  * add system.defaults into virtual-offline-(ssl|pike-ovs)/infra/init.yml
  * Switch reclass submodule to forever-master
  * Fix few other mirrors

Change-Id: I220627dc4484ddeed14f9546569bc6c2e06fda67
diff --git a/classes/cluster/virtual-offline-ssl/openstack/compute.yml b/classes/cluster/virtual-offline-ssl/openstack/compute.yml
index dc75093..6cde820 100644
--- a/classes/cluster/virtual-offline-ssl/openstack/compute.yml
+++ b/classes/cluster/virtual-offline-ssl/openstack/compute.yml
@@ -1,8 +1,7 @@
 classes:
-- system.linux.system.repo_local.mcp.apt_mirantis.openstack
-- system.linux.system.repo_local.mcp.extra
+- system.linux.system.repo.mcp.apt_mirantis.extra
 - system.linux.system.repo.mcp.apt_mirantis.saltstack
-- system.linux.system.repo_local.mcp.apt_mirantis.ceph
+- system.linux.system.repo.mcp.apt_mirantis.openstack
 - system.linux.network.hosts
 - system.linux.storage.loopback
 - system.nova.compute.cluster
diff --git a/classes/cluster/virtual-offline-ssl/openstack/control.yml b/classes/cluster/virtual-offline-ssl/openstack/control.yml
index b196b83..aa7010a 100644
--- a/classes/cluster/virtual-offline-ssl/openstack/control.yml
+++ b/classes/cluster/virtual-offline-ssl/openstack/control.yml
@@ -2,10 +2,11 @@
 - system.salt.minion.cert.proxy
 - system.linux.system.lowmem
 - system.linux.system.repo.mcp.apt_mirantis.glusterfs
-- system.linux.system.repo_local.mcp.apt_mirantis.openstack
-- system.linux.system.repo_local.mcp.extra
+- system.linux.system.repo.mcp.apt_mirantis.openstack
+- system.linux.system.repo.mcp.apt_mirantis.percona
+- system.linux.system.repo.mcp.apt_mirantis.extra
 - system.linux.system.repo.mcp.apt_mirantis.saltstack
-- system.linux.system.repo_local.mcp.apt_mirantis.ceph
+- system.linux.system.repo.mcp.apt_mirantis.ceph
 - system.memcached.server.single
 - system.rabbitmq.server.cluster
 - system.rabbitmq.server.vhost.openstack
diff --git a/classes/cluster/virtual-offline-ssl/openstack/dashboard.yml b/classes/cluster/virtual-offline-ssl/openstack/dashboard.yml
index b897c93..51bb0cf 100644
--- a/classes/cluster/virtual-offline-ssl/openstack/dashboard.yml
+++ b/classes/cluster/virtual-offline-ssl/openstack/dashboard.yml
@@ -1,8 +1,8 @@
 classes:
 - system.linux.system.repo.mcp.apt_mirantis.ubuntu
-- system.linux.system.repo_local.mcp.apt_mirantis.openstack
-- system.linux.system.repo_local.mcp.extra
+- system.linux.system.repo.mcp.apt_mirantis.openstack
 - system.linux.system.repo.mcp.apt_mirantis.saltstack
+- system.linux.system.repo.mcp.apt_mirantis.extra
 - system.horizon.server.single
 - cluster.virtual-offline-ssl
 parameters:
diff --git a/classes/cluster/virtual-offline-ssl/openstack/gateway.yml b/classes/cluster/virtual-offline-ssl/openstack/gateway.yml
index 98321cc..8fa9924 100644
--- a/classes/cluster/virtual-offline-ssl/openstack/gateway.yml
+++ b/classes/cluster/virtual-offline-ssl/openstack/gateway.yml
@@ -1,6 +1,6 @@
 classes:
-- system.linux.system.repo_local.mcp.apt_mirantis.openstack
-- system.linux.system.repo_local.mcp.extra
+- system.linux.system.repo.mcp.apt_mirantis.openstack
+- system.linux.system.repo.mcp.apt_mirantis.extra
 - system.linux.system.repo.mcp.apt_mirantis.saltstack
 - system.neutron.gateway.cluster
 - cluster.virtual-offline-ssl
@@ -85,4 +85,4 @@
           use_interfaces:
           - ${_param:external_interface}
           use_ovs_ports:
-          - float-to-ex
\ No newline at end of file
+          - float-to-ex
diff --git a/classes/cluster/virtual-offline-ssl/openstack/share.yml b/classes/cluster/virtual-offline-ssl/openstack/share.yml
index 1d083f3..0a49abe 100644
--- a/classes/cluster/virtual-offline-ssl/openstack/share.yml
+++ b/classes/cluster/virtual-offline-ssl/openstack/share.yml
@@ -1,8 +1,8 @@
 classes:
 - system.linux.system.lowmem
 - system.linux.system.repo.mcp.apt_mirantis.ubuntu
-- system.linux.system.repo_local.mcp.apt_mirantis.openstack
-- system.linux.system.repo_local.mcp.extra
+- system.linux.system.repo.mcp.apt_mirantis.openstack
+- system.linux.system.repo.mcp.apt_mirantis.extra
 - system.linux.system.repo.mcp.apt_mirantis.saltstack
 - system.linux.storage.loopback_manila
 - system.manila.share
diff --git a/classes/cluster/virtual-offline-ssl/openstack/telemetry.yml b/classes/cluster/virtual-offline-ssl/openstack/telemetry.yml
index a59b9a7..a3d8230 100644
--- a/classes/cluster/virtual-offline-ssl/openstack/telemetry.yml
+++ b/classes/cluster/virtual-offline-ssl/openstack/telemetry.yml
@@ -1,10 +1,10 @@
 classes:
 - system.salt.minion.cert.proxy
-- system.linux.system.repo_local.mcp.apt_mirantis.openstack
-- system.linux.system.repo_local.mcp.extra
+- system.linux.system.repo.mcp.apt_mirantis.openstack
+- system.linux.system.repo.mcp.apt_mirantis.extra
 - system.linux.system.repo.mcp.apt_mirantis.saltstack
 - system.linux.system.repo.mcp.apt_mirantis.glusterfs
-- system.linux.system.repo_local.mcp.apt_mirantis.ceph
+- system.linux.system.repo.mcp.apt_mirantis.ceph
 - system.memcached.server.single
 - system.apache.server.single
 - system.apache.server.site.gnocchi